[LU-3454] open (O_TRUNC) and truncate(0) on a released file must not trig a restore Created: 11/Jun/13  Updated: 05/Aug/20  Resolved: 30/Aug/13

Status: Resolved
Project: Lustre
Component/s: None
Affects Version/s: None
Fix Version/s: None

Type: New Feature Priority: Blocker
Reporter: CEA Assignee: Jinshan Xiong (Inactive)
Resolution: Duplicate Votes: 0
Labels: HSM, MB

Issue Links:
Duplicate
is duplicated by LU-3817 Fix sanity-hsm test 58: "Truncate 0 o... Resolved
Related
is related to LU-3817 Fix sanity-hsm test 58: "Truncate 0 o... Resolved
is related to LU-3818 Fix sanity-hsm test 59: "Truncate != ... Closed
is related to LU-3608 HSM Master Ticket for 2.5 Landings Resolved
Rank (Obsolete): 8635

 Description   

HSM restore is triggered on data access, to avoid useless restore, it is better to remove released state at open(O_TRUNC) or truncate(0).
For truncate(size != 0) a full restore must be done first (a partial one can be done in a futur patch).



 Comments   
Comment by Peter Jones [ 12/Jun/13 ]

Jinshan

I understand that you are assisting with HSM-related work

Peter

Comment by Jinshan Xiong (Inactive) [ 23/Aug/13 ]

I;m working on this issue.

Generated at Sat Feb 10 01:34:03 UTC 2024 using Jira 9.4.14#940014-sha1:734e6822bbf0d45eff9af51f82432957f73aa32c.